Job Summary
We are seeking a skilled and experienced licensed Journeyman Electrician to join our team.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in electrical systems, with the ability to work independently and collaboratively on various projects. This role requires experience in both commercial and residential electrical work, ensuring compliance with safety regulations and industry standards.
Duties
•Install, maintain, and repair electrical systems and equipment in commercial and residential settings.
•Read and interpret blueprints, schematics, and technical drawings to determine installation requirements.
•Utilize hand tools, power tools, and testing equipment to troubleshoot electrical issues.
•Work with low voltage systems ensuring proper functionality and safety.
•Collaborate with other trades on construction sites to complete projects efficiently and safely.
•Conduct routine inspections of electrical systems to identify potential hazards or necessary repairs.
•Adhere to all safety protocols while performing tasks on construction sites.
Skills
•Proficient in using hand tools and power tools relevant to electrical work.
•Strong understanding of electrical theory and principles.
•Experience with low voltage systems.
•Ability to read blueprints and technical drawings accurately.
•Excellent problem-solving skills with a keen attention to detail.
•Strong communication skills for effective collaboration on job sites.
•Familiarity with safety regulations and best practices in the electrical trade.
